Right now 14 people are running to be mayor of San Antonio, three city councilmen are vacating, six people are running for the district 8 seat, ten are running for the district 9 seat, ten are running for the district 10 seat, and there is an $850 Million Bond on our May ballot.
So this month we will host candidates from the races for San Antonio City Council. We will have the chance to personally ask them about city issues that concern us and make our own judgments.
We know city elections have incredibly low turnout, so learning what is at stake and getting our peers out to vote will have measurable effects. Our city, our neighborhoods, our traffic, our water, our tax money, our parks, our services, our safety and our quality of life are in the hands of the people at city hall, so let’s raise the bar for the candidates.
